Transaction 64bd0bd587ae76cb339a2057249080d16cf225a41b30ae0f201be16323f747c9
1 Input
1 Output
-
64bd0bd587ae76cb339a2057249080d16cf225a41b30ae0f201be16323f747c9:0
- value
- 50133
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4ddce27c13b591bb76999480fcb5b4f9293b96dca5ef511ccf57963e773bbc21
- address
- bc1pfhwwylqnkkgmka5ejjq0edd5ly5nh9ku5hh4z8x027truaemhsssqh040z